Hellfire is the official (but non-canon) singleplayer expansion pack for Diablo that was developed by Sierra instead of Blizzard. It adds new dungeons, character classes, and items, but was never supported in the same way as the base game.

Powered by the Quake Engine, Hexen II is a first-person shooter that follows one of four different character classes as they fight their way through several distinct continents searching for Eidolon, the last Serpent Rider.

Featuring two new 32-level episodes for Doom II: Hell on Earth, Final Doom is a community-developed standalone expansion that features some of the most difficult level sets (designed to finally break even the most hardcore of Doom veterans).
Master Levels for Doom II is an expansion pack for Doom II comprising 21 "Master Levels" officially sanctioned by id Software. It also contains Maximum Doom, a compilation of nearly 3,000 user-created levels.

Released in 1995, The Ultimate Doom refined elements of deathmatch, and added a completely new episode of content to the original game.
After the events of Doom, Hell has found its way to Earth. The last living scientists develop a plan to evacuate what's remaining of the human race with enormous space ships. Unfortunately, the demons have taken control of the only spaceport, and it's up to the nameless space marine to take it back.

A role-playing game in which the player must gather a party of four warriors and battle the evil Lord Terarin. Originally released in 1986 for Japanese home computers, it was ported to the Master System in 1987 and translated into English.
